Welcome to this week’s top social media stories: Snapchat does AR with a banknote, Facebook launched Creator Studio for mobile and YouPorn introduced Swyp.
Snapchat got a spike in popularity this week as the platform launched a new AR Lense that brings the £20 banknote to life. Go try it (if you live in the UK) or watch the video in our article.
Let’s also talk about how Nando’s “grilled” Burger King and its moldy burger. Nice burn (pun intended.)
